 What Are Safety Trolleys?

 

It would then be crucial to define what safety trolleys and purposes are in order to discuss installation and usage. A safety trolley refers to a wheeled platform used to move equipment, materials, and tools with safety as the priority. Trolleys have been employed for most industries that need mobility and organization of heavy or cumbersome loads. They come in different designs, such as manual, powered, and adjustable, especially suited for different applications.

 

In addition to their function of increasing the convenience factor, safety trolleys come equipped with safety features, such as a non-slip surface, brakes, and ergonomic grips, to make them easier to handle by workers.  Key Considerations of Installation for Safety Trolley

 

Installing safety trolleys requires several considerations to ensure they function as expected and provide maximum safety to workers. Below are the key aspects in setting up a safety trolley:

 

  1. Surface Assessment

Surface: This is crucial to employing the use of the safety trolley. Ensure that the floor is level, smooth, and clear of any obstructions. Irregular or rough surfaces will cause instability in the trolleys, and this will lead to the increase of chances of tipping over, among others, or in having a problem with the movement of heavy loads. For an uneven surface, oversize wheels or trolleys with rough terrain design should be used.

 

  1. Wheel Selection and Setup

One of the critical aspects of installation of a trolley is the selection of the right wheels. In addition, the wheels must be fastened to the trolley, allowing it to roll smoothly with stability on the appropriate surface. Ideally, when installing a safety trolley, it will ensure that the wheels are correctly aligned and locked into place. The selected wheels should fit appropriately for the weight and surface type. A big wheel is useful when used for rugged terrain, and even the smallest wheels are best used for smooth even flooring.

 

  1. Brakes and Locking Mechanism

Safety trolleys must always have installed brakes. Upon their installation, the brakes should be secured to function. Hence, brakes are expected to ‘lock’ a trolley if stationary or at least when it is carrying heavy loads or unstable loads. In addition, its wheels’ locking mechanisms should also be smooth and tight for there would be no rolling unknowingly.

 

  1. Handle Placement and Adjustment

Safety trolley handles should be installed at ergonomic height for the workers. Poor positioning of the handles may result in stretching, which contributes to harm on the back, shoulders, or wrists. For mounting handles, they should be mounted at comfortable heights so that the worker can push or pull the trolley without too much bending or stretching. Adjustable handles would be very practical because the length may vary according to the different types of workers and personal preference in use.

 

  1. Weight Distribution

Once you repair the safety trolley, balanced weight distribution is key. Load evenly so that the weight will be balanced on the platform to avoid tipping. Overloading one side or placing too much weight on the trolley will make it unstable and increase the chances of accidents. Ensure that the load will not be too heavy for the trolley as per the manufacturer’s advice.

 

  1. Regular Inspection and Maintenance

Even when installing, all parts of the trolley should be investigated to ensure that they are all in good working condition. Determine if the wheels, brakes, handles, and platform are in condition and if they look damaged or worn out. After an installation has been completed, conduct a load test by placing weight on the trolley to determine whether it can carry maximum capacity as set by the manufacturer. Periodic inspection and maintenance should be maintained after installation to ensure the trolley is always in prime working condition.

 

Usage of Safety Trolleys

 

 

As with the installation, proper usage of safety trolleys is also important. Workers should be taught the right usage of safety trolleys to avoid unwanted strain, injury, or accidents.

 

  1. Loading and Unloading

While there is loading or unloading on the safety trolley, safety precautions are as follows:

 

 

– The load must be spread evenly across the platform.

– Never exceed the weight limit of the trolley.

Use the trolley to shift materials instead of carrying them manually to minimize injuries.

Avoid hands or feet near the wheels when loading or unloading material.

 

  1. Pushing vs. Pulling

Always push and not pull when operating a safety trolley. Pushing is the safer method because it gives better control and one is able to utilize power in the legs, which are stronger than the back or arms. Pulling a trolley also poses a high risk of straining the back or shoulder as when it is loaded with heavy items.

 

Second, always push the trolley in front of you instead of trying to walk behind it. This provides you a better view of the surroundings and ensures better control, mainly when maneuvering through tight spaces.

  1. Controlling When Walking

In handling a trolley, be sure that the load is tied down properly and will not shift during transfer. Be sure, when necessary, the trolley wheels are locked to prevent an unintentional roll with the trolley. It is also helpful to slow down in busy or hazardous areas when handling a trolley to avoid abrupt stops or impacts in handling a trolley.

 

  1. Moving Around Obstacles and Corners

Be slow when you make corners or any hindrances with a safety trolley. Always ensure the route to make a turn is clear of any obstructions before you make a turn. It is advisable that those swivel casters safety trolleys be used for easy maneuverability around corners since they take off the stress from the trolley making it turn without much force and thus avoid toppling over when trying to do sharp turns with heavy loads.

 

  1. Regular Cleaning and Maintenance

One of the things that prolongs the life of your safety trolley and make it do a good job would be regular cleaning and maintenance. Cleaning the trolley after use is one very important activity; you must remove all dirt, debris, or even spills. The wheels are to be greased and its condition checked for signs of wear and tear. All this will make sure that there is no breakdown, it is safe to use, and prolong its service life.

 

  1. Training Workers

All workers should be given proper training on safety trolleys’ safe operating procedures. Employee training on employee operation includes loading and unloading, driving through, and checking for defects before utilization of the safety trolleys. Good worker training minimizes accidents and ensures optimum usage and performance of the trolleys.

 

 Common Problems and Troubleshooting

 

While trolleys for safety are built to last, they encounter problems due to age. Checking regularly and curing the problems is important for maintaining their safety and efficiency. Some common complaints relate to the following points.

– Worn-out wheels: Sometimes one cannot roll the trolley further because of the worn-out state of the wheels. Replace the old wheel with a new one. It may save you from many accidents once the movement of the trolley becomes tedious.

– Faulty brakes: If brakes have failed to engage, inspect the brake pads or the locking system. Brakes are supposed to be serviced from time to time to ensure proper working order.

– Loose handles: Loose or unstable handles have to be tightened or replaced to avoid accidents in using such trolleys.
